Dialing and Saving Phone Numbers With Pauses
You can dial or save phone numbers with pauses for use with automated
systems, such as voicemail or credit card billing numbers. If you select a
hard pause, the next set of numbers are sent when you press
. If you
select a 2-second pause, your phone automatically sends the next set of
numbers after two seconds.
Note:
You can have multiple pauses in a phone number and combine
2-second and hard pauses.
To dial or save a phone number with pauses:
1.
When in standby mode, enter the first digits of the phone number
that comes before the required pause.
2.
Press
to open the Menu options.
3.
Press
for Hard Pause or
for a 2sec Pause. (Hard Pauses
are displayed as a “P” and 2sec Pauses as a “T”.)
4.
Enter the additional numbers.
Note:
Complete step three and four again, if necessary.
5.
Press
to dial.
When dialing a number with a hard pause, highlight
Send Tones
and
press
to send the next set of numbers.
